Self-love can have many positive effects on a person's life,
including:
- Better
mental health
Self-love can help reduce anxiety, depression, anger, and
loneliness. It can also increase feelings of support and encouragement.
- Improved
self-care
People who love themselves tend to take care of their
physical and mental health. This can include eating well, exercising, and
meditating.
- Stronger
boundaries
Self-love involves knowing your limits and communicating
them to others. This can include saying no to requests that don't align
with your priorities.
- Reduced
stress
Self-love can help lower stress and protect you from
negative thoughts and self-sabotage.
- Increased
self-trust
Self-love involves believing in your ability to handle
life's ups and downs.
- Greater
self-compassion
·
Self-love involves being kind to yourself,
especially when times are tough.
